Kees Cook 8877df8135 LoadPin: Ignore the "contents" argument of the LSM hooks
[ Upstream commit 1a17e5b513 ]

LoadPin only enforces the read-only origin of kernel file reads. Whether
or not it was a partial read isn't important. Remove the overly
conservative checks so that things like partial firmware reads will
succeed (i.e. reading a firmware header).
